Output dcf333b76eaacad76e985986c66fc58d3ec95f64317683482a6df7df2fcabf94:4

value
37000
script pubkey
OP_0 OP_PUSHBYTES_20 91c8564045035fdab76f38cf94ffac9dd6c7781e
address
bc1qj8y9vsz9qd0a4dm08r8eflavnhtvw7q7jsg93j
transaction
dcf333b76eaacad76e985986c66fc58d3ec95f64317683482a6df7df2fcabf94